Using transgenic mice harboring a targeted LacZ insertion, we studied the expression pattern of the C90RF72 mouse ortholog (3110043021Rik). Unlike most genes that are mutated in amyotrophic lateral sclerosis (ALS), which are ubiquitously expressed, the C90RF72 ortholog was most highly transcribed in the neuronal populations that are sensitive to degeneration in ALS and frontotemporal dementia. Thus, our results provide a potential explanation for the cell type specificity of neuronal degeneration caused by C90RF72 mutations.
